Designer Brands Inc is a designer, producer, and retailer of footwear and accessories. The company operates in two reportable segments: the Retail segment and the Brand Portfolio segment. The Retail segment, which derives key revenue, operates the DSW Designer Shoe Warehouse ("DSW") banner through its direct-to-consumer stores and e-commerce sites in the United States ("U.S.") and Canada, and the Shoe Co. and Rubino banners through its direct-to-consumer stores and e-commerce sites in Canada. The Brand Portfolio segment principally earns revenue from the wholesale of its exclusive and licensed brands to retailers, its Retail segment, and international distributors, and the sale of its Vince Camuto, Keds, and Topo brands through direct-to-consumer e-commerce sites.
